Thou son of man, speak unto every feathered fowl, &c. — It was the custom of persons that offered sacrifice, to invite their friends to the feast that was made of the remainder: see Genesis 31:54; 1 Samuel 9:13.So here the prophet, by God’s command, invites the beasts and fowls to partake of the sacrifice of his enemies slain.
